Product Specifications
Specification | Details |
---|---|
Product Code | 07AC91 GJR5252300R0101 |
Type | Industrial Control Component |
Power Supply | 24V DC ± 10% |
Input Voltage | 10-30 V DC |
Output Current | Max 2A |
Communication Interface | Modbus RTU |
Enclosure | IP20 Protection |
Operating Temperature | -10°C to +60°C |
Storage Temperature | -25°C to +85°C |
Dimensions | 120 x 140 x 85 mm |
Weight | 0.45 kg |
Mounting | DIN Rail Mountable |
Status Indicators | LED indicators for status and fault |
Certifications | CE, UL |
